Overview
Banana Park is a densely urban neighborhood in Paramount, California, known for its tight housing market with virtually no vacancies.
The area features mostly medium to small single-family homes and mobile homes, many built between 1940 and 1969, with a mix of owners and renters.

Commute
Most Banana Park residents have short to moderate commutes, primarily driving alone.
Banana Park residents mostly rely on private vehicles with efficient commute times.
| Typical Commute Time | 15-30 minutes |
|---|---|
| Drive Alone Rate | 79.1% |
| Carpool Rate | 14.8% |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the median home price in Banana Park?
The median home price is $752,039, more expensive than 37.6% of California neighborhoods.
How diverse is Banana Park?
The neighborhood has a high concentration of residents with Mexican ancestry (80.1%) and a majority speak Spanish at home (76.0%).
What is the vacancy rate?
Banana Park has a 0.0% vacancy rate, indicating very tight housing supply.
